After facing criticism for his inappropriate speech at a recent film event, director Mysskin has now apologized for his remarks. During the audio launch, his use of swear words upset fans and people in the industry.
In his apology, Mysskin expressed regret and said he understood how his words could have impacted others, including the producer and his colleagues.
He mentioned he was sorry to lyricist Thamarai, director Lenin Bharath, actor Aruldoss, actress Lakshmy Ramakrishnan, producer Thanu, and his fans.
Mysskin also humorously addressed a comment from a friend who threatened to throw a shoe at him, jokingly asking for two shoes in his size.
The director also apologized to filmmakers Ameer and Vetri Maran, explaining that his words were meant to be playful but had gone too far. He asked for forgiveness, acknowledging that his speech was inappropriate.
